Crime overview

Meynell Square area has the 79th lowest crime rate of 168 local areas in Hunslet & Riverside , and the 569th highest crime rate of 2,526 local areas in Leeds .

At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Meynell Square (LS11 9QA) in the last 12 months was 166.7 per 1,000 residents and was 58.9% lower than the Hunslet & Riverside average (405.8 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 19 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Bicycle theft 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Public order ( -50.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 22 (≈ 111.1 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-21.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-34.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Meynell Square (LS11 9QA),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Top Moor Side, where police recorded 39 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Meynell Approach (22 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
